EU to Tony Blair: Turn the screws on the Jews

Source: www.jnewswire.com

 

Ten European Union foreign ministers Monday messaged newly-appointed Middle East envoy Tony Blair to increase the pressure on Israel to make more "concessions for peace."

 

And they let the former British prime minister know that they want to see an international conference on the Arab-Israeli conflict convened, one at which Israel would stand decidedly alone against the pro-"Palestinian" world.

 

They also called for an examination of the idea, put forward by Abbas, that a robust international force be brought into the PA areas to impose a ceasefire between rival Arab factions.

 

Israel has always resisted suggestions that foreign troops be introduced into the Jews' ancient homeland, knowing that once inside it would be difficult to get them out.

Evangelicals and Muslims met in Egypt

Source: www.washingtontimes.com

 

Muslims and evangelical Christians are talking — at least behind closed doors at the Egyptian Embassy — according to several guests at a top-secret lunch last week.

 

The July 2 gathering lasted two hours and featured ambassadors from nine Arab states plus their umbrella group, and several prominent evangelical leaders or their sons.

 

"They were assessing the next generation," said Richard Cizik, vice president for governmental affairs of the National Association of Evangelicals (NAE) and one of the participants. "The meeting was reflective of the generational changes that are happening, and everyone knew it."

 

The meeting, which was orchestrated by Pentecostal evangelist Benny Hinn, focused on two issues, though the two groups had differing priorities. Whereas the Americans wanted to discuss the lack of religious freedom in Muslim countries, the ambassadors wanted to know whether Christians could become more "balanced" in their support of Israel.

 

"One of the ambassadors mentioned that American Christians seemed always to favor Israel in all situations, even when Israel was wrong," wrote the Rev. Jonathan Falwell, son of the late Rev. Jerry Falwell and pastor of Thomas Road Baptist Church in Lynchburg, Va., in a column last week for WorldNetDaily.com that described the meeting as "historic."

 

"The Egyptian ambassador [Nabil Fahmy] began by graciously saying that we should not worry about diplomacy at this meeting," wrote Mr. Falwell, who attended along with Ron Godwin, executive vice president of Liberty University. "He went on to emphasize that we should have an open, honest conversation about what is necessary for bridges to be built between Islam and American Christians."

Barroso says EU is an 'empire'

Source: EUObserver.com

 

Veering into uncharted naming territory after being asked on Tuesday (10 July) by a journalist what kind of a structure the 27-nation bloc is, Mr Barroso said "We are a very special construction unique in the history of mankind,"

 

"Sometimes I like to compare the EU as a creation to the organisation of empire. We have the dimension of empire," he said.

 

He went on the clarify that instead of like super state empires of old, the EU empire is built on voluntary pooling of power and not on military conquest.

 

"What we have is the first non-imperial empire," said the centre-right Mr Barroso, who was formally Portugal's prime minister.

 

"We have 27 countries that fully decided to work together and to pool their sovereignty. I believe it is a great construction and we should be proud of it."

Israeli FM Tzipi  Livni: Israel should not enter talks with Syria

Source: Jerusalem Post

 

Israel should not talk to Syria, and the region as a whole should deal with the country, Foreign Minister Tzipi Livni said in an interview with French magazine Le Nouvel Observateur on Thursday.

 

Livni also said Syria is "the regional center of support for terrorism," and its association with Iran creates danger for the region.

 

Earlier Thursday Reuters reported that Syria has signalled to the UN's Middle East envoy a willingness to change its relationship with Iran, Hizbullah and Hamas if progress were made towards a peace deal with Israel.

 

UN special envoy Michael Williams told Reuters in an interview that he has conveyed to top Israeli officials his "impressions" from talks with Syrian leaders in recent months, but acknowledged deep-rooted suspicions on both sides would make reviving the peace process difficult.
